Asking Prices Surge to a Record High

While the pandemic continues, home prices are accelerating and, in some markets, began to edge into previously uncharted territory this month. The national median listing price in July was $349,000—a record high, realtor.com® reports in its latest Monthly Housing Trends report. Further, homes are selling just as fast as they were last year. Pending Home Sales Rise 16.6%

Contracts to buy U.S. previously owned homes increased more than expected in June, the latest indication that the housing market was weathering the COVID-19 pandemic far better than the broader economy.
